Iterative encoding is used to allow quantization step size, motion prediction and quantization levels to be optimized despite their interrelated nature. Jun, 2006 an entropy processor is built as a bit stream processor. For example, a file that is intended for users of microsoft windows media player who connect to the internet by using cable modems will have one set of requirements while users of realplayer who. Fpga based high performance cavlc implementation for. You may still print any of the forms and write in your information if you prefer. A comparative evaluation between cabac and cavlc article in journal of testing and evaluation 463. Actions products may contain design defects or errors known as anomalies or errata which may.
Model vustream e210 vustream e220 vustream e240 hardware network 1x 1gbs lan 2x 1gbs lan 2x 1gbs lan dimensions 21. If you have problems with acrobat reader or our pdf form, select pdf troubleshooting. The cavlc is an important technique that used for reducing the bit stream realization of the coefficients. A separate paper addresses the cabac entropy coding case. An apparatus comprising a first circuit, a second circuit and an output circuit. For example, if two out of three flags are raised, two 32bit chunks are forwarded to fifo register. The throughput of the presented cavlc encoders is more than 10 times higher than that of published software encoders on dsp and multicore platforms. An efficient hardware architecture of cavlc encoder based. It is an alternative to contextbased adaptive binary arithmetic coding cabac. Core resource reference list for teachers ey to 8 201617.
Expgolomb codes exponential golomb codes are variable length codes with a regular construction. Lic 424, record of clients cash resources for change of. If you cannot pay this fee, complete the declaration of financial hardship form. This paper presents the framework along with an example for h. Contextadaptive binary arithmetic coding cabac is a form of entropy encoding used in the h.
For each processing path, three stages are performed, that is, coefficient scan, symbol coding, and bitstream output. A method of encoding video data using soft decision quantization makes use of iterative encoding to provide the ability to optimize encoding across different functional elements in a hybrid video encoder. Trans form m otion c ompens tation d eblocking b its tream p roces s ing c a v l c c a b a c invers e trans form m otion c ompens tation d eblocking b its tream p roces s ing c a v l c c a b a c invers e trans form m otion c ompens tation d eblocking. Posts viewing 1 post of 1 total you must be logged in to reply to this topic. Exploring flash player support for highdefinition h. Transform quantization cavlc inverse transform inverse quantization deblocking filter figure 1. The encoding procedure of the example is also shown in table ii. The preembedding analysis can generate a substitution table and the embedder can simply select entries from the table based on the payload. David poole algebra linear pdf printer cavlc example pdf form. Approval for alterations to school building andor grounds request form.
Aglc is taking the covid19 coronavirus matter seriously. It is by far the most commonly used format for the recording, compression, and distribution of video content, used by 91% of video industry developers as of september 2019. Highefficient parallel cavlc encoders on heterogeneous. Us7061410b1 method andor apparatus for transcoding. Cavlc is listed in the worlds largest and most authoritative dictionary database of abbreviations and acronyms the free dictionary. We implemented the proposed framework by cuda on nvidias gpu. Vlsi architectures of cavlc and cabac encoders in h. In addition, cavlc algorithm improves the entropy coding performance by using coding techniques such as runlevel and trailing ones coding that are designed to take advantage of the characteristics of the 4x4 blocks of transformed and quantized residual data 2, 3, 4. Application for a canada pension plan retirement pension 9. Cabac is notable for providing much better compression than most other entropy. Figure 5 cavlc example the reordered data of the block are in the form of 0,3,0,1,1, 1,0,1, 0, 0, 0, 0, 0, 0, 0, 0. So far i get that cavlc is older than cabac and cabac has better efficiency at lower bitrates by 1015% but requires more resources to encode and decode it over cavlc. Application for a canada pension plan retirement pension.
The paper presents an efficient implementation of contextadaptive variable length coding cavlc entropy encoder in h. English1 introduction streaming series products are audiovideo encodertranscoder servers especially designed and developed by avermedia technologies, inc. Design of a high speed cavlc encoder and decoder with. Implementation of intrapredictions, transform, quantization and. The entropy processor will transcode, in realtime, between cabac and cavlc entropy coding of an h. The standard describes the decoding process and the bitstream format in details while encoding process is not specified at all in order to allow designers to choose their own method of encoding. State, and zip code sacramento, ca 942712872 check this box if any of the above information has changed standardization only county submit a separate form for each county tulare citrus program only total woighl divided by 40 lbs determine 40 1b carton equivalent 7 4125 assessment. Not only the compute intensive components of the h. Keywords cavlc, software parallel, heterogeneous multicore, realtime hd. Cavlc is listed in the worlds largest and most authoritative dictionary database of abbreviations and acronyms. Failure to report a disclosable pleaconviction may be grounds for denial of your application. In this scheme, intersymbol redundancies are exploited by switching vlc tables for various syntax elements depending on already transmitted coding symbols 1, 2.
Contextadaptive variablelength coding cavlc is a form of entropy coding used in. Direct tablelookup implementation requires higher cost because it employs a larger memory. For example, as shown in table 2, the codewords 1001, 1011, 1101, and 1111 can form g 2. The forms below have been updated to fillable pdf formats. Unless otherwise specified, no part of this publication may be reproduced or utilized in any form or by any means, electronic or mechanical, including photocopying and microfilm, without permission in writing from either iso at the address below or. Based on the proposed codeword classification, one example of g 1 and g 2 is given in fig. Cavlc runbefore decoding scheme qualcomm incorporated.
Contextadaptive variablelength coding cavlc is a form of entropy coding used in h. An example of the cavlc algorithm is shown in figure 1. Contextbased adaptive binary arithmetic coding in the h. Criminal pleaconviction form that is available on the forms and applications page on cslbs website. Securely hiding information in compressed video streams. In accordance with adobes licensing policy, this file may be printed or viewed but. Vhdl implementation of an efficient context adaptive variable. Efficient parallel video processing techniques on gpu. If you choose to file an appeal with the court, complete the notice of appeal form. Contextbased adaptive variablelength coding cavlc is a new and important feature of. Us7061410b1 method andor apparatus for transcoding between. The design of cabac is in the spirit of our prior work.
Vhdl implementation of an efficient context adaptive. Fpga based high performance cavlc implementation for h. Authors personal copy contextbased entropy coding in avs video coding standard li zhanga, qiang wangb, ning zhangc, debin zhaob, xiaolin wuc, wen gaod a key lab of intelligent information processing, institute of computing technology, chinese academy of sciences, beijing, china b department of computer science and engineering, harbin institute of technology, harbin, china. Information given in this document is provided just as a reference or example for the purpose of us ing actions products, and cannot be treated as a part of any quotation or contract for sale. It is used for coding both luminance and chrominance blocks. Direct tablelookup implementation requires higher cost because it employs a. Contextadaptive binary arithmetic coding wikipedia. An entropy processor is built as a bit stream processor. Us court of appeals for veterans claims court forms and fees. Looking for online definition of cavlc or what cavlc stands for. The cavlc method, however, cannot provide an adaptation to the actually given conditional symbol statistics. An efficient hardware architecture of cavlc encoder based on. To circumvent the drawbacks of the known entropy coding schemes for hybrid blockbased video coding such as annex e of h. Contextadaptive variable length coding cavlc is a part of entropy.
The cisco mxe 3500 uses encoder profiles to set parameters that govern how uncompressed preprocessor output will be compressed for distribution. Through reorganizing the execution order and optimizing the data structure, we proposed an efficient parallel framework for h. Contextbased adaptive variablelength coding cavlc is an. We partitioned the cavlc into four paths according to the four components of a frame. One aspect of cavlc calls for successively encoding the number of zeros separating each nonzero coefficient from the previous nonzero coefficient in a scan, i. Mpeg4 systems file format has been modified to support it.
To adapt to the local statistical features of dct coef. Context adaptive variablelength coding cavlc for encoding the transformed coefficients after quantization. It is an inherently lossless compression technique, like almost all entropycoders. The reordered data of the block are in the form of 0,3,0,1,1. Pdf disclaimer this pdf file may contain embedded typefaces. Ee573 project report oo analysisdesign of cabac, and uml. Second, some older encoding tools do not offer output directly into f4v format. It is a lossless compression technique, although the video coding standards in which it is used are typically for lossy compression applications. Contextadaptive variable length coding cavlc 2 and contextbased adaptive binary arithmetic coding cabac8 in h. The first circuit may be configured to generate i one of a first set of entropy coded input signals or a second set of entropy coded input signals and ii a data path signal. The entropy processor guarantee of realtime performance on a picture level can support multiplexed bidirectional transcoding. The architecture is designed with a parallel structure targeting realtime video compression. The information provided will be verified through cslbs fingerprinting requirement.
The form must be saved as a pdf file, filled out, and then submitted via email to. Direct deposit for canada only for direct deposit outside canada, please contact us at 18002779914 from the united states and at 69902244 from all other countries we accept collect calls. Cavlc is designed to exploit the characteristics of nzs and works in several steps. The second circuit may be configured to generate i a first set of entropy encoded output signals in response to decoding the second set. A comparative evaluation between cabac and cavlc request pdf. The entropy processor guarantee of realtime performance on a picture. Streaming series products provide comprehensive allinone servers to demands in audiovideo encodertranscoder and. Compared to a typical cavlc decoder whose decoding cycle is 22, we can reduce 59% of cycles. A comparative evaluation between cabac and cavlc request. Us8005140b2 soft decision and iterative video coding for. The proposed cavlc encoder, named componentbased cavlc, is shown in figure 9. Ags a set of unix commands for neutron data reduction.
1615 618 769 1345 1280 1404 1188 1264 603 1572 859 791 1296 1627 448 869 1293 552 583 1132 557 1219 1134 693 657 473 313 643 998 498 830